Who is this course for?
This course is designed for individuals working across banking, investment and insurance who are looking to understand the risks of the global sustainability crisis and identify the opportunities for a sustainable transition in the finance sector.
It provides crucial foundational sustainability knowledge and supports professional development, decision-making and strategic planning for financial institutions seeking to embed impact and sustainability risk mitigation into their practice, today and in the long term.
- Individuals looking to start their sustainable finance journey, refresh their understanding with the latest knowledge in sustainable finance practices, and who want to drive sustainability and deliver impact within their organisation and across the finance sector.
- Organisations looking to upskill their staff by building a foundational understanding of sustainable finance practices in specific teams or across the business.
- Financial institutions looking to transition to a sustainable economy.
What will I learn from the course?
Through 6 modules delivered by experts from industry and academia, this course enables you to:
- Understand global pressures and trends, their commercial implications, and why business as usual is no longer viable.
- Evaluate the role of business in society and explore what leading practice looks like within financial institutions and the future direction of travel.
- Assess how financial institutions can support the transition to a more sustainable economy and compare their practical actions on Environmental, Social and Governance (ESG) and sustainability.
- Create a personal action plan to contribute to the necessary change in your organisation or sphere of influence.
